Digital escape rooms with time twists are my guilty pleasure during work breaks! Unlike traditional setups, online versions often use interactive videos or AR elements—like this one where my phone camera 'transported' my desk into a 1920s speakeasy. The puzzles required solving past riddles to unlock future clues, and honestly, it felt like being in a 'Doctor Who' episode. Some indie developers on itch.io create low-budget but genius time-bending games; 'Loop DeLock' had me restarting the same 10-minute segment until I broke the cycle by noticing subtle changes. The downside? No tactile props, but the trade-off is mind-bending narratives that’d be impossible IRL.

Twisted time escape rooms? Oh, they absolutely can be played online, and let me tell you, some of them are wild. I stumbled into one last year called 'Chrono Break' where you hop between different eras to solve puzzles—like decoding Victorian letters while simultaneously hacking a futuristic AI. The beauty of digital versions is how they bend logic with time loops and alternate endings that physical rooms can't replicate. Platforms like Escape Simulator or Discord-hosted games often feature fan-made time-warping scenarios, complete with eerie soundtracks and glitch effects that mess with your perception.

What hooked me was the communal chaos—voice chats erupting when someone realizes the '1984' clue affects the '2145' timeline. It’s not just about puzzles; it’s about collective time-travel panic. If you’re into meta-narratives, 'The Paradox Arc' even lets you collaboratively rewrite the room’s history mid-game. Just brace for existential dread when the clock starts counting backward.

Ever tried explaining a time-loop escape room to your grandma? I did, after playing 'Temporal Trespass' online with friends. These games thrive on digital flexibility—think branching paths where your choice in WWII affects a cyberpunk dystopia later. The best part? No room bookings or travel. We once spent three hours in 'Rewind Reality', screaming at a shared Google Doc that updated in 'real time' (except time was fake). Developers get creative with tools like Twine or Unity, crafting non-linear stories where you might control multiple versions of your character. Pro tip: Wear headphones. The ticking clocks and distorted voices in these games will haunt your dreams (in the best way).

How do twisted time escape rooms work?

4 Answers2026-04-28 15:56:50
Twisted time escape rooms are such a wild ride! The concept plays with nonlinear storytelling—you might start in a Victorian era lab, solve a puzzle, and suddenly teleport to a futuristic spaceship. The 'time travel' is usually triggered by hidden mechanisms or code inputs that change the room's decor/soundscape instantly. I tried one where a grandfather clock's hands spun backward, lights flickered, and boom—we were in a 1920s speakeasy. The coolest part? Some puzzles require leaving clues in 'past' rooms to affect 'future' ones, like a self-referential loop. What makes them next-level is the attention to detail. A diary found early might contain dates you need to input later, or a radio broadcast could hint at timelines merging. It’s not just about locks and keys; it’s about causality. The one I did in Kyoto even had scent diffusers—burnt wood smell for medieval sections, ozone for sci-fi zones. Gets your brain firing in 4D!

What themes do twisted time escape rooms typically have?

4 Answers2026-04-28 23:30:48
Twisted time escape rooms are my absolute jam! They often play with mind-bending concepts like paradoxes, alternate timelines, or being trapped in a loop. One of my favorites had us reliving the same hour over and over, 'Groundhog Day' style, where every action subtly changed the environment. Another brilliant one involved repairing a broken time machine while clues from 'future us' kept appearing—notes we’d supposedly write later. The best part? These rooms love subverting expectations. Just when you think you’ve cracked it, the rules shift. Some sprinkle in historical eras (Victorian detectives meeting futuristic AI), while others go full sci-fi with dystopian countdowns. The tension of racing against a clock—sometimes literally—makes every second electrifying. What hooks me is how they blend storytelling with puzzles. You aren’t just solving locks; you’re unraveling a narrative where time itself is the antagonist. I still get chills remembering a room where our past decisions haunted us via holographic 'echoes.' If you dig psychological layers mixed with adrenaline, these themes are pure gold.

Where can I read Escape Room novel online for free?

4 Answers2025-11-10 13:29:42
I totally get the urge to dive into 'Escape Room' without breaking the bank! While I’m all for supporting authors, sometimes budget constraints are real. You might want to check out platforms like Project Gutenberg or Open Library—they often have legal free reads, though newer titles like 'Escape Room' might not pop up there. Another angle is your local library’s digital services; apps like Libby or Hoopla let you borrow e-books for free with a library card. If you’re into audiobooks, sometimes YouTube or Spotify has fan-read chapters (though quality varies). Just a heads-up: sketchy sites offering 'free' downloads often pirate content, which hurts creators. Maybe try a trial of Kindle Unlimited? It’s not free long-term, but they sometimes have promo months where you can binge-read thrillers guilt-free.
